CPI in first ten months is lowest in last five years

The Consumer Price Index (CPI) in October was down by 0.2 per cent from September, meaning the CPI in the first ten months of this year grew 1.81 per cent over the same period last year, the lowest growth rate since 2016.

Hoa Sen Group posts US$189 million after-tax profit

Steel maker Hoa Sen Group (HSG) posted revenue of VNĐ48.7 trillion (US$2.14 billion), representing an increase of 77 per cent year-on-year in the fourth quarter of its fiscal year 2020-21 from October 1, 2020 to September 30, 2021.
